two.two Get in touch with Resistance & Conductivity with time

Pain level:

Even thoroughly installed connectors could degrade over time because of contact resistance maximize, Particularly with aluminium conductors or combined aluminium/copper junctions. That raises Strength losses, warmth Develop-up and failure possibility.

Sicame’s response:

Sicame utilizes bimetallic tin-plated copper enamel for compatibility with aluminium or copper. They emphasise regular electrical Get in touch with by using their style and design.

N.I.U ELEC’s response:

N.I.U ELEC states that their TTD151F supports copper-to-copper, aluminium-to-aluminium or blended connections, and the improved product science reduces power losses and extends lifespan.

2.three Environmental Sealing & Corrosion Resistance

ache issue:

outside installations (pole lines, coastal zones, rural overhead) confront UV, salt-fog, temperature cycling, humidity ingress. very poor sealing contributes to corrosion, insulation breakdown, and connector failure.

Sicame’s reaction:

Their product description notes a water resistant, thoroughly insulated entire body rated for UV-stable and flame-retardant environments.

N.I.U ELEC’s response:

N.I.U ELEC emphasizes UV-resistant content, self-seam body for waterproofing and corrosion resistance, enabling “all-weather conditions” application.

3. FAQ

Q1: Can insulation piercing connectors be mounted on Reside conductors?

Sure — some IPCs are created for Stay-function branch connections without isolating the supply. having said that, the installer ought to continue to satisfy basic safety laws for Dwell Doing work.

Q2: Do I have to strip the insulation just before applying an IPC?

No — among the most important benefits of present day IPCs is they pierce the insulation on their own, removing the necessity for stripping.

Q3: Are IPCs appropriate for all conductor styles (aluminium, copper)?

fashionable superior-excellent IPCs are suitable with aluminium, copper, and blended-steel connections via bimetallic contacts. one example is, both organizations reviewed support aluminium and copper.

This autumn: What environmental tests must I request?

essential checks contain salt-fog corrosion, climatic/UV ageing, water immersion (e.g., endure 6 kV in immersion) and mechanical cycling.

Q5: what exactly is a sensible lifespan for these connectors?

when lifespan depends on natural environment and cargo, suppliers normally focus on many years of support (twenty-thirty+ many years) if installed and maintained accurately. lessen maintenance frequency contributes to decreased total lifecycle cost.
